首页 > 精选资讯 > 严选问答 >

Excel如何固定几行不动

更新时间:发布时间:

问题描述:

Excel如何固定几行不动,真的急死了,求好心人回复!

最佳答案

推荐答案

2025-07-08 00:38:04

Excel如何固定几行不动】在使用 Excel 进行数据处理时,经常需要将某些行(如标题行)固定在屏幕上,以便在滚动查看数据时始终能看到这些信息。以下是几种常见的方法,帮助你实现“固定几行不动”的效果。

一、

1. 冻结窗格功能:这是最常用的方法,适用于固定顶部或左侧的行列。

2. 使用 VBA 宏:适合高级用户,可实现更复杂的固定逻辑。

3. 分页预览模式:虽然不是真正固定,但可以辅助查看表格结构。

4. 调整视图方式:通过“视图”选项卡中的设置,优化显示效果。

二、表格展示

方法 操作步骤 适用场景 是否推荐
冻结窗格 选中要固定的行下方单元格 → 点击“视图”→“冻结窗格”→“冻结首行/冻结首列/冻结所选单元格” 固定标题行或列 ✅ 推荐
使用 VBA 宏 打开 VBA 编辑器 → 插入模块 → 输入代码 → 运行宏 高级需求,如动态固定 ⚠️ 建议进阶用户
分页预览模式 点击“视图”→“分页预览” 查看打印效果 ❌ 不推荐用于日常操作
调整视图方式 使用“视图”→“缩放”或“窗口”→“拆分” 辅助查看数据 ⚠️ 仅辅助作用

三、详细说明

1. 冻结窗格(推荐)

- 步骤:

1. 选择你要固定的行下面的单元格(例如:如果要固定第一行,选择第二行的任意单元格)。

2. 点击菜单栏上的“视图”。

3. 在“窗口”组中找到“冻结窗格”。

4. 选择“冻结首行”、“冻结首列”或“冻结所选单元格”。

- 优点:操作简单,适合大多数用户。

- 缺点:只能固定固定区域,不能动态调整。

2. 使用 VBA 宏(进阶)

- 示例代码:

```vba

Sub FreezeFirstRow()

Range("A2").Select

ActiveWindow.FreezePanes = True

End Sub

```

- 适用情况:需要在不同工作表中自动固定不同行时使用。

- 注意:需熟悉 VBA 编程基础。

3. 分页预览模式

- 适用情况:查看打印效果时,可看到页面布局。

- 局限性:无法实际固定行,只是辅助查看。

4. 调整视图方式

- 操作:使用“缩放”功能可以放大或缩小内容,便于查看。

- 拆分窗口:可以将窗口分为两个部分,方便对比查看。

四、小贴士

- 如果你需要固定多行,可以选择多行后使用“冻结所选单元格”。

- 冻结后,可以通过“取消冻结窗格”恢复原状。

- 多个工作表中可以分别设置不同的冻结方式。

通过以上方法,你可以灵活地在 Excel 中固定几行不动,提升工作效率。根据实际需求选择合适的方式即可。

免责声明:本答案或内容为用户上传,不代表本网观点。其原创性以及文中陈述文字和内容未经本站证实,对本文以及其中全部或者部分内容、文字的真实性、完整性、及时性本站不作任何保证或承诺,请读者仅作参考,并请自行核实相关内容。 如遇侵权请及时联系本站删除。